Elastin-derived peptide VGVAPG decreases differentiation of mouse embryo fibroblast (3T3-L1) cells into adipocytes

Elastin is a highly elastic protein present in connective tissue. As a result of protease activity, elastin hydrolysis occurs, and during this process, elastin-derived peptides (EDPs) are released.
